
Pirates Head Coach Tom Rowe Named Florida Panthers Associate General Manager

Portland, ME - Florida Panthers General Manager Dale Tallon announced today that Portland Pirates Head Coach Tom Rowe has been named the Associate General Manager with the Panthers.
In conjunction with this move, Portland Pirates General Manager Eric Joyce announced that Scott Allen will be the Pirates' new Head Coach. He will be assisted on the bench in the team's upcoming games by Pirates Goalie Coach Pierre Groulx. A search has commenced for a new full-time assistant coach.
Rowe, a 59 year-old native of Lynn, Massachusetts, joined the Panthers organization on November 8, 2013, when he was named the Head Coach of Florida's previous AHL affiliate, the San Antonio Rampage.
Rowe became the eighth Head Coach in Portland Pirates history on July 1, when the Panthers affiliation with the Pirates took effect. In 29 games before his promotion, he guided the Pirates to a 16-12-1-0 record.
The Pirates were the fourth AHL team that Rowe served as a Head Coach. Over parts of seven seasons, Rowe also coached the Lowell Lock Monsters (2004-06), the Albany River Rats (2006-08), and San Antonio (2013-15), compiling a record of 243-196-25-26, good for a 0.548 career winning percentage.
Over his coaching career, Rowe has also worked as an Assistant Coach with the Lock Monsters and the NHL's Carolina Hurricanes, as well as a Head Coach with Lokomotiv Yaroslavl of Russia's Kontinental Hockey League.
Allen, a 49 year-old New Bedford, Massachusetts native, began his Head Coaching duties last night with the Pirates 4-3 victory over the Providence Bruins at Cross Insurance Arena. He joined the Panthers organization at the start of the 2014-15 season as the Assistant Coach with the San Antonio Rampage. He also moved on to the Pirates with the new affiliation before this season began.
This is the third time in Allen's coaching career that he will take over an AHL team during the season. In both the 2001-02 and the 2002-03 season, Allen guided the Rampage to a 28-45-2-8 mark in 83 games.
Allen has also served as an AHL Assistant Coach with the Omaha Ak-Sar-Ben Knights, the Quad City Flames, Peoria Rivermen, and Chicago Wolves. He has also spent time as both an Assistant and Head Coach with the ECHL's Johnstown Chiefs and as an Assistant Coach with the NHL's New York Islanders.
Groulx, a native of Ridgeway, Ontario, is in his first season as the Portland Pirates Goalie Coach. He began his second stint with the Florida Panthers organization this season after serving as Florida's Goalie Coach from 2005-09. After that, Groulx moved on to become the Goalie Coach of the NHL's Montreal Canadiens from 2009-13.
